I use brand new bubble mailers, penny sleeves, team bags, and recycled toploaders.

It costs me just under $2 to ship, and I charge $2. Never had a complaint.

Sellers shipping for free are usually overcharging for the card/s, or trying to build up feedback with cheap sales.

Up to 3oz thru paypal is 1.75...add .20 for misc supplies----that puts you at 1.95 total for shipping.

3.99 - 1.95 = 2.04 maybe those people are happy making 2.04 a card. selling a couple hundred 2.00 cards a week = nice week.

The 3.99 BIN, or even 2.99 BIN, free shipping model is absolutely one that makes sense as described.

I charge 2.75, and that covers the following:

$1.75 postage
$0.28 Team Bag/Toploader/Penny Sleeve. Some are used, but more than half the time, they're new. It's a guesstimated price.
$0.15 Bubble Mailer. I buy in lots of 100. I sell at a pace where 100 lasts me 3-4 months, which is fine for me.
$0.27 Postage eBay Fee. ($2.75 * about 10%)
$0.30 PayPal payment fee. I include these two fees because they're independent of what the card sells for, thus really have nothing to do with what I'm selling. In other words, I let my buyer shoulder these burdens as 'handling'.

So that totals $2.75, I gain no profit whatsoever from shipping. Some people take a little for their time and/or gas, and I'm fine with that. For me, anything up to $3.50 can be termed as 'fair'. But I always take shipping into account when buying, as I frequently buy low-end autos.
